A groundbreaking new destination for motorsport fans has opened its doors in the heart of?Las Vegas. Spanning 100,000 square feet, the newly launched Formula 1 attraction at Grand Prix Plaza constitutes the largest immersive F1 experience in North America. Located within the 39-acre?Las Vegas Grand Prix?complex, the entertainment destination offers three main attractions—F1 X, F1 DRIVE and F1 HUB—along with multiple event venues designed for high-end gatherings.

F1 X
A 20,000-square-foot journey through the heritage and future of Formula 1, F1 X combines historic artifacts with interactive activations. Guests begin their adventure by creating a Pit Pass and personalized driver profile before diving into the experience’s three key zones:
- Learn: Start at the ETC—a broadcast center replica that simulates the action of a live race. From there, guests encounter lifelike holograms of iconic F1 personalities and explore “75 Years of F1,” a walk through the sport’s timeline from 1950 to 2025. Rare items on display include original race cars, helmets, suits and trophies, many of which are being shown in North America for the first time. The “F1 Factory” exhibit highlights engineering advancements, with items like Lando Norris’ 2021 race seat, a unique 2022 McLaren front wing and a 2023 Aston Martin AMR23 replica.
- Create: Visitors can customize their own F1 race car in the Design Studio, selecting colors and livery that are then projection-mapped onto a life-size car body—perfect for a photo-op.
- Experience: A hands-on section that puts fans in the driver’s seat. The “Pit Wall Experience” simulates race-day strategy with real-time team communication, while the “Pit Stop Demo” allows guests to try their hand at a tire change using real pit crew tools. In the “Driver Briefing Room,” the mental and physical demands of racing at the highest level are explored. The finale is a hyper-realistic “4D Theater” ride through the Las Vegas Strip Circuit, complete with helmet-cam visuals, engine sounds, motion effects and the scent of burning rubber. The experience wraps up in the “Cool Down Room” with branded photo ops and a celebratory podium moment.
F1 DRIVE
The first karting attraction of its kind in North America, F1 DRIVE places guests on a segment of the actual Las Vegas Strip Circuit. The high-speed indoor/outdoor course extends 1,696 feet with 31 technical turns. Drivers race in karts inspired by F1 technology, capable of hitting speeds up to 30 mph and loaded with features like a Drag Reduction System (DRS), Energy Recovery System (ERS), LED steering displays and realistic engine sounds.
- The Karts: Karts are equipped with LCD steering wheel displays showing lap times, interval gaps and boost indicators. Drivers hear authentic 2023 F1 engine sounds and receive guidance from a virtual Race Engineer, who provides track status, DRS/ERS cues and overtaking tips.
- The Track: The circuit includes demanding corners like hairpins, chicanes double apexes. Kerbs decorated with playing cards offer an homage to the Las Vegas Strip Circuit’s flair.
F1 HUB
The social center of the destination, F1 HUB brings fans together for dining, racing simulators, shopping and lounge-style relaxation. No ticket is required to access the store or restaurant.
- Fuel & Fork: This sleek eatery offers elevated comfort cuisine ranging from hand-crafted pasta to gourmet sliders and pizzas. Featured dishes include Slow-Braised Short Rib Bucatini, Truffle Smash Burger, Spicy Pig Pizza and Caviar Sliders. Guests can enjoy cocktails while watching race replays on large screens. Open daily for lunch and dinner. Reservations encouraged.
- F1 SIMS: Advanced simulators let guests experience pro-level racing with motion technology and immersive audio-visual effects.
- Flagship F1 Store: Styled like a Formula 1 garage, the retail space houses the largest selection of official F1 merchandise in the U.S., including Las Vegas exclusives and customizable items. A replica of Fernando Alonso’s Ferrari F138 is also on display. Nevada residents receive a 10 percent discount.
- F1 HUB Lounge: A stylish setting where guests can sip F1-themed cocktails and watch racing content in a more laid-back environment.
Grand Prix Plaza is open Sunday through Thursday from 10:00 a.m. to 10:00 p.m. and Friday through Saturday from 10:00 a.m. to midnight. The attraction will temporarily close in early fall to accommodate race preparations, with a reopening date to be announced.
